    With the confirmation straight from BlackBerry mouth that Flash is gone, and having two features of the new system (Android Player and Remember) really worth upgrading, I am dreaming of the hybrid OS.
    Someone already mentioned that s/he was able to extract 10.2 browser and use it in the 10.3, any instructions how to do that?

    It would go a bit like this... Draft btw.

    Download 10.2 OS, extract, get the browser .bar and its dependencies if it has any, upload onto your own phone and it'll install automatically. But I'm sure there are probably alternatives to get flash rather than doing this, maybe like using a Android browser that has flash (i.e Dolphin browser).

    Sorry OP, but that wouldn't help. The fully functioning browser is only partially contained in the separate file you could swap. The main browser components are embedded in the OS itself. (this has been explained by the OS experts in leak threads).

    As suggested, Photon or Dolphin browsers have flash capability. For the times you need to go to a site using flash, these are a couple of the available options.
